What have you been doing since leaving Exeter, and what are you doing now?

After leaving Exeter in September 2024, I moved to London. I currently work as a Project Officer for London Sport, a charity working to make physical activity more accessible across the city, particularly in the more deprived areas. 

Why did you choose this career? And what do you enjoy most about your work?

I chose this career because I am interested in the use of physical activity in the prevention & treatment of ill-health. I believe everyone should have the opportunities to be active, no matter who they are or where they live. What I enjoy most about my current role is being able to work on such a wide range of projects across the city.
